Benefit of Treating Hepatocellular Carcinoma Recurrence after Liver Transplantation and Analysis of Prognostic Factors for Survival in a Large Euro-American Series.

Abstract

PURPOSE: To identify prognostic factors after hepatocellular carcinoma (HCC) recurrence after liver transplantation (LT).
METHODS: We retrospectively reviewed the combined experience at Toronto General Hospital and Hospital Vall d'Hebron managing HCC recurrence after LT (n = 121) between 2000 and 2012. We analyzed prognostic factors by uni- and multi-variate analysis. Median follow-up from LT was 29.5 (range 2-129.4) months. Median follow-up from HCC recurrence was 12.2 (range 0.1-112.5) months.
RESULTS: At recurrence, 31.4 % were treated with curative-intent treatments (surgery or ablation), 42.1 % received palliative treatment, and 26.4 % received best supportive care. The 1-, 3-, and 5-year survivals, respectively, after HCC recurrence were 75, 60, and 31 %, vs. 60, 19, and 12 %, vs. 52, 4, and 5 % (p < 0.001). By multivariate analysis, not being amenable to a curative-intent treatment [hazard ratio (HR) 4.7, 95 % confidence interval (CI) 2.7-8.3, p < 0.001], α-fetoprotein of ≥100 ng/mL at the time of HCC recurrence (HR 2.1, 95 % CI 1.3-2.3, p = 0.002) and early recurrence (<12 months) after LT (HR 1.6, 95 % CI 1.1-2.5, p = 0.03) were found to be poor prognosis factors. A prognostic score was devised on the basis of these three independent variables. Patients were divided into three groups, as follows: good prognosis, 0 points (n = 22); moderate prognosis, 1 or 2 points (n = 84); and poor prognosis, 3 points (n = 15). The 1-, 3-, and 5-year actuarial survival for each group was 91, 50, and 50 %, vs. 52, 7, and 2 %, vs. 13, 0, and 0 %, respectively (p < 0.001).
CONCLUSIONS: Patients with HCC recurrence after transplant amenable to curative-intent treatments can experience significant long-term survival (~50 % at 5 years), so aggressive management should be offered. Poor prognosis factors after recurrence are not being amenable to a curative-intent treatment, α-fetoprotein of ≥100 ng/mL, and early (<1 year) recurrence after LT.
